Home
last modified time | relevance | path

Searched refs:ecx (Results 1 – 25 of 2076) sorted by relevance

12345678910>>...84

/external/llvm-project/llvm/test/tools/llvm-mca/X86/BtVer2/
Dxadd.s5 xadd %ecx, (%rsp)
6 add %ecx, %ecx
7 add %ecx, %ecx
8 imul %ecx, %ecx
9 imul %ecx, %ecx
13 lock xadd %ecx, (%rsp)
14 add %ecx, %ecx
15 add %ecx, %ecx
16 imul %ecx, %ecx
17 imul %ecx, %ecx
[all …]
Dxchg.s4 xchg %ecx, (%rsp)
5 add %ecx, %ecx
6 add %ecx, %ecx
7 imul %ecx, %ecx
8 imul %ecx, %ecx
29 # CHECK-NEXT: 3 16 16.00 * * xchgl %ecx, (%rsp)
30 # CHECK-NEXT: 1 1 0.50 addl %ecx, %ecx
31 # CHECK-NEXT: 1 1 0.50 addl %ecx, %ecx
32 # CHECK-NEXT: 1 3 1.00 imull %ecx, %ecx
33 # CHECK-NEXT: 1 3 1.00 imull %ecx, %ecx
[all …]
/external/rust/crates/quiche/deps/boringssl/mac-x86/crypto/fipsmodule/
Dsha256-586.S35 movl (%edx),%ecx
37 testl $1048576,%ecx
40 testl $16777216,%ecx
42 andl $1073741824,%ecx
44 orl %ebx,%ecx
45 andl $1342177280,%ecx
46 cmpl $1342177280,%ecx
59 movl 8(%edi),%ecx
64 bswap %ecx
67 pushl %ecx
[all …]
Dmd5-586.S18 movl 20(%esp),%ecx
20 shll $6,%ecx
22 addl %esi,%ecx
23 subl $64,%ecx
25 pushl %ecx
27 movl 8(%edi),%ecx
32 movl %ecx,%edi
45 xorl %ecx,%edi
48 xorl %ecx,%edi
57 leal 606105819(%ecx,%ebp,1),%ecx
[all …]
/external/boringssl/linux-x86/crypto/fipsmodule/
Dsha256-586.S36 movl (%edx),%ecx
38 testl $1048576,%ecx
41 testl $16777216,%ecx
43 andl $1073741824,%ecx
45 orl %ebx,%ecx
46 andl $1342177280,%ecx
47 cmpl $1342177280,%ecx
60 movl 8(%edi),%ecx
65 bswap %ecx
68 pushl %ecx
[all …]
Dmd5-586.S19 movl 20(%esp),%ecx
21 shll $6,%ecx
23 addl %esi,%ecx
24 subl $64,%ecx
26 pushl %ecx
28 movl 8(%edi),%ecx
33 movl %ecx,%edi
46 xorl %ecx,%edi
49 xorl %ecx,%edi
58 leal 606105819(%ecx,%ebp,1),%ecx
[all …]
/external/rust/crates/quiche/deps/boringssl/linux-x86/crypto/fipsmodule/
Dsha256-586.S36 movl (%edx),%ecx
38 testl $1048576,%ecx
41 testl $16777216,%ecx
43 andl $1073741824,%ecx
45 orl %ebx,%ecx
46 andl $1342177280,%ecx
47 cmpl $1342177280,%ecx
60 movl 8(%edi),%ecx
65 bswap %ecx
68 pushl %ecx
[all …]
Dmd5-586.S19 movl 20(%esp),%ecx
21 shll $6,%ecx
23 addl %esi,%ecx
24 subl $64,%ecx
26 pushl %ecx
28 movl 8(%edi),%ecx
33 movl %ecx,%edi
46 xorl %ecx,%edi
49 xorl %ecx,%edi
58 leal 606105819(%ecx,%ebp,1),%ecx
[all …]
/external/boringssl/mac-x86/crypto/fipsmodule/
Dsha256-586.S35 movl (%edx),%ecx
37 testl $1048576,%ecx
40 testl $16777216,%ecx
42 andl $1073741824,%ecx
44 orl %ebx,%ecx
45 andl $1342177280,%ecx
46 cmpl $1342177280,%ecx
59 movl 8(%edi),%ecx
64 bswap %ecx
67 pushl %ecx
[all …]
Dmd5-586.S18 movl 20(%esp),%ecx
20 shll $6,%ecx
22 addl %esi,%ecx
23 subl $64,%ecx
25 pushl %ecx
27 movl 8(%edi),%ecx
32 movl %ecx,%edi
45 xorl %ecx,%edi
48 xorl %ecx,%edi
57 leal 606105819(%ecx,%ebp,1),%ecx
[all …]
/external/openscreen/third_party/boringssl/linux-x86/crypto/fipsmodule/
Dsha256-586.S36 movl (%edx),%ecx
38 testl $1048576,%ecx
41 testl $16777216,%ecx
43 andl $1073741824,%ecx
45 orl %ebx,%ecx
46 andl $1342177280,%ecx
47 cmpl $1342177280,%ecx
60 movl 8(%edi),%ecx
65 bswap %ecx
68 pushl %ecx
[all …]
Dmd5-586.S19 movl 20(%esp),%ecx
21 shll $6,%ecx
23 addl %esi,%ecx
24 subl $64,%ecx
26 pushl %ecx
28 movl 8(%edi),%ecx
33 movl %ecx,%edi
46 xorl %ecx,%edi
49 xorl %ecx,%edi
58 leal 606105819(%ecx,%ebp,1),%ecx
[all …]
/external/openscreen/third_party/boringssl/mac-x86/crypto/fipsmodule/
Dsha256-586.S35 movl (%edx),%ecx
37 testl $1048576,%ecx
40 testl $16777216,%ecx
42 andl $1073741824,%ecx
44 orl %ebx,%ecx
45 andl $1342177280,%ecx
46 cmpl $1342177280,%ecx
59 movl 8(%edi),%ecx
64 bswap %ecx
67 pushl %ecx
[all …]
Dmd5-586.S18 movl 20(%esp),%ecx
20 shll $6,%ecx
22 addl %esi,%ecx
23 subl $64,%ecx
25 pushl %ecx
27 movl 8(%edi),%ecx
32 movl %ecx,%edi
45 xorl %ecx,%edi
48 xorl %ecx,%edi
57 leal 606105819(%ecx,%ebp,1),%ecx
[all …]
/external/openscreen/third_party/boringssl/win-x86/crypto/fipsmodule/
Dsha256-586.asm41 mov ecx,DWORD [edx]
43 test ecx,1048576
46 test ecx,16777216
48 and ecx,1073741824
50 or ecx,ebx
51 and ecx,1342177280
52 cmp ecx,1342177280
65 mov ecx,DWORD [8+edi]
70 bswap ecx
73 push ecx
[all …]
Dmd5-586.asm23 mov ecx,DWORD [20+esp]
25 shl ecx,6
27 add ecx,esi
28 sub ecx,64
30 push ecx
32 mov ecx,DWORD [8+edi]
37 mov edi,ecx
50 xor edi,ecx
53 xor edi,ecx
62 lea ecx,[606105819+ebp*1+ecx]
[all …]
/external/boringssl/win-x86/crypto/fipsmodule/
Dsha256-586.asm41 mov ecx,DWORD [edx]
43 test ecx,1048576
46 test ecx,16777216
48 and ecx,1073741824
50 or ecx,ebx
51 and ecx,1342177280
52 cmp ecx,1342177280
65 mov ecx,DWORD [8+edi]
70 bswap ecx
73 push ecx
[all …]
Dmd5-586.asm23 mov ecx,DWORD [20+esp]
25 shl ecx,6
27 add ecx,esi
28 sub ecx,64
30 push ecx
32 mov ecx,DWORD [8+edi]
37 mov edi,ecx
50 xor edi,ecx
53 xor edi,ecx
62 lea ecx,[606105819+ebp*1+ecx]
[all …]
/external/llvm-project/llvm/test/MC/X86/
Dx86_operands.s67 v_ecx = %ecx
72 #CHECK: movl %eax, %ecx
89 #CHECK: movl $1, %gs:(%ecx)
90 movl $1, v_gs:(%ecx)
91 #CHECK: movl $1, %gs:(%ecx)
92 movl $1, v_gs:(%ecx,)
93 #CHECK: movl $1, %gs:(%ecx,%eax)
94 movl $1, v_gs:(%ecx,%eax)
95 #CHECK: movl $1, %gs:(%ecx,%eax,2)
96 movl $1, v_gs:(%ecx,%eax,2)
[all …]
Dx86-32-coverage.s14 movb $0x7f,0xdeadbeef(%ebx,%ecx,8)
34 movw $0x7ace,0xdeadbeef(%ebx,%ecx,8)
54 movl $0x7afebabe,0xdeadbeef(%ebx,%ecx,8)
74 movl $0x13572468,0xdeadbeef(%ebx,%ecx,8)
94 movsbl 0xdeadbeef(%ebx,%ecx,8),%ecx
98 movsbl 0x45,%ecx
102 movsbl 0x7eed,%ecx
106 movsbl 0xbabecafe,%ecx
110 movsbl 0x12345678,%ecx
114 movsbw 0xdeadbeef(%ebx,%ecx,8),%bx
[all …]
/external/llvm/test/MC/X86/
Dx86-32-coverage.s13 movb $0x7f,0xdeadbeef(%ebx,%ecx,8)
33 movw $0x7ace,0xdeadbeef(%ebx,%ecx,8)
53 movl $0x7afebabe,0xdeadbeef(%ebx,%ecx,8)
73 movl $0x13572468,0xdeadbeef(%ebx,%ecx,8)
93 movsbl 0xdeadbeef(%ebx,%ecx,8),%ecx
97 movsbl 0x45,%ecx
101 movsbl 0x7eed,%ecx
105 movsbl 0xbabecafe,%ecx
109 movsbl 0x12345678,%ecx
113 movsbw 0xdeadbeef(%ebx,%ecx,8),%bx
[all …]
Dintel-syntax.s81 mov [eax], ecx
83 mov [4*ebx], ecx
85 mov [ebx*4], ecx
87 mov [1024], ecx
89 mov [0x1024], ecx
91 mov [16 + 16], ecx
93 mov [16 - 16], ecx
95 mov [16][16], ecx
97 mov [eax + 4*ebx], ecx
99 mov [eax + ebx*4], ecx
[all …]
/external/cpuinfo/tools/
Dcpuid-dump.c10 eax, regs.eax, regs.ebx, regs.ecx, regs.edx); in print_cpuid()
13 static void print_cpuidex(struct cpuid_regs regs, uint32_t eax, uint32_t ecx) { in print_cpuidex() argument
15 eax, regs.eax, regs.ebx, regs.ecx, regs.edx, ecx); in print_cpuidex()
19 if (regs.ebx | regs.ecx | regs.edx) { in print_cpuid_vendor()
23 memcpy(&vendor_id[8], &regs.ecx, sizeof(regs.ecx)); in print_cpuid_vendor()
25 eax, regs.eax, regs.ebx, regs.ecx, regs.edx, vendor_id); in print_cpuid_vendor()
35 memcpy(&brand_string[8], &regs.ecx, sizeof(regs.ecx)); in print_cpuid_brand_string()
38 eax, regs.eax, regs.ebx, regs.ecx, regs.edx, brand_string); in print_cpuid_brand_string()
51 for (uint32_t ecx = 0; ; ecx++) { in main() local
52 const struct cpuid_regs regs = cpuidex(eax, ecx); in main()
[all …]
/external/llvm-project/llvm/test/tools/llvm-mca/X86/BdVer2/
Dresources-tbm.s4 bextr $8192, %ebx, %ecx
5 bextr $8192, (%rbx), %ecx
10 blcfill %eax, %ecx
11 blcfill (%rax), %ecx
16 blci %eax, %ecx
17 blci (%rax), %ecx
22 blcic %eax, %ecx
23 blcic (%rax), %ecx
28 blcmsk %eax, %ecx
29 blcmsk (%rax), %ecx
[all …]
/external/llvm-project/llvm/test/tools/llvm-mca/X86/Generic/
Dresources-tbm.s4 bextr $8192, %ebx, %ecx
5 bextr $8192, (%rbx), %ecx
10 blcfill %eax, %ecx
11 blcfill (%rax), %ecx
16 blci %eax, %ecx
17 blci (%rax), %ecx
22 blcic %eax, %ecx
23 blcic (%rax), %ecx
28 blcmsk %eax, %ecx
29 blcmsk (%rax), %ecx
[all …]

12345678910>>...84